This workshop introduces community orchardists to the role of cover crops in improving soil health, supporting beneficial insects, and increasing overall ecosystem diversity. Participants will learn how to select cover crops for different orchard goals—such as weed suppression, nitrogen fixation, erosion control, and pollinator support—along with timing for planting, termination, and integration around young and established trees. The session will emphasize practical, scalable approaches that build resilient orchard systems while aligning with the realities of community-managed sites.
